On , OSHA opened a complaint safety inspection of BASIC METALS in HARRINGTON STREET, WILEY FORD, WV 26767 (NAICS 331410). OSHA activity number 335456380.

What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ons: rout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1910.106(b)(2)(vii)(a):     Area(s) surrounding tank(s) containing flammable or combustible liquids were not provided with adequate drainage or dikes:    (a) Diesel Fuel Dispensing Area:  A 275 gallon tank of Diesel fuel was used by employees to dispense diesel into a New Holland Skid Steer, model LX865. The tank was not surrounded by a dike or provided with adequate drainage, as determined on or about 07/24/2012.    Note:  See 1910.106(b)(2)(vii)(b) and (c) for specific drainage and diking requirements.     ABATEMENT CERTIFICATION REQUIRED

29 CFR 1910.303(b)(2):     Listed or labeled electrical equipment was not used or installed in accordance with instructions included in the listing or labeling:    (a) Shop; North End and West End: Electrical outlet boxes, 110 volts, were not set in a fixed location; it was being used as an extension cord to power a Diesel Tank Pump and a Uniden cordless phone, and a Weigh Scale. The boxes were not installed and used in accordance with National Electric Code (NEC) 336, in that it was not protected from damage and not supported as required, as observed on or about 07/24/2012.    ABATEMENT CERTIFICATION REQUIRED

29 CFR 1910.134(c)(2)(i):     Respirator users were not provided with the information contained in Appendix D to 29 CFR 1910.134 when the employer determined that any voluntary respirator use was permissible:    (a) Shop; Grinding Area: Employees wear a single string dust mask, no s/n or model number, voluntarily while conducting grinding operations. The employer did not provide the employees with the information found in Appendix D of 1910.134, as determined on or about 07/24/2012.    ABATEMENT CERTIFICATION REQUIRED

29 CFR 1910.141(c)(1)(i):     Toilet facilities were not provided in accordance with TABLE J-1 of this Section:    (a) Basic Metals; Shop: Employees work in the shop 8 hours a day 5 days a week. The employer has not provided any toilet facilities for the employees, as determined on or about 07/24/2012.    ABATEMENT CERTIFICATION REQUIRED

29 CFR 1910.1200(e)(1):     The employer did not develop, implement, and/or maintain at the workplace a written hazard communication program which describes how the criteria specified in 29 CFR 1910.1200(f), (g), and (h) will be met:    (a) Basic Metals: The employer had not developed a written chemical hazard communication program for employees who use hazardous chemicals including, but not limited to, Diesel Fuel, which contains Napthalene, as determined on or about 07/24/2012.    ABATEMENT NOTE:  A written program shall include a description of how the criteria for the following will be met:    1.        Labeling and other forms of warnings;  2.        Material Safety Data Sheets;  3.        Employee information and training.    Additionally, a list of hazardous chemicals known to be present in the workplace must be compiled.  Methods used to inform employees of the hazards associated with non-routine tasks and the informing of contractors of workplace hazards, including a description of the labeling system used in the facility and the availability of material safety data sheets, must also be addressed.  The written program must be made available upon request.    ABATEMENT CERTIFICATION REQUIRED

29 CFR 1910.1200(g)(1):     The employer did not have a material safety data sheet for each hazardous chemical in use:    (a) Basic Metals; Shop: Employees use hazardous chemicals including, but not limited to, Diesel Fuel, which contains Napthalene, to fill the fuel tanks of a New Holland Skid Steer, model LX865. The employees were not provided material safety data sheets for hazardous materials such as Diesel Fuel, as determined on 07/24/2012.    ABATEMENT CERTIFICATION REQUIRED
